Assateague Island National Seashore Campground

Image Source:https://s3-us-east-2.amazonaw…

Assateague Island National Seashore Campground is operated by the National Park Service. Assateague is a barrier island in the Atlantic Ocean shared by Maryland and Virginia, but camping is only allowed in the Maryland section. Assateague Island is most famous for its wild horses that are believed to have lived there since the 17th century.

Maryland Camping: Swallow Falls State Park

Filled with centuries-old hemlock trees and the highest waterfall in Maryland, Swallow Falls State Park boasts some of the state’s most stunning scenery. The campground offers more than 60 sites equipped with fire pits and picnic tables, and all sites include access to a bathhouse with hot water. There are also three sites with full hookups advance reservations are recommended if you’d like to secure one of these spots. If you’d like to spend the night in a bit more comfort, there are also three cabins with electric heat and beds. A two-night minimum stay is required for all sites on weekends.

2470 Maple Glade Rd, Oakland, MD 21550, Phone: 301-387-6938

Camping In Maryland: Cunningham Falls State Park

Set in the stunning Catoctin Mountains, Cunningham Falls State Park is home to a 43-acre lake, plenty of meandering streams, and the biggest waterfall in the state. Visitors are permitted to camp in two different areas, one with more than 100 basic sites and another with just over 20 basic sites. Both campgrounds have a handful of sites with electric hookups as well, and reservations are strongly recommended for both types of site. The park is open to campers all throughout the year, but full amenities are only available between the beginning of April and the end of October.

14039 Catoctin Hollow Rd, Thurmont, MD 21788, Phone: 301-271-7574

Delaware Seashore State Park

Frontier Town Campground Ocean City MD Review, Drone, & Drive Thru S2E5

Delaware Seashore State Park covers 6 miles of ocean and 20 miles of bay shoreline, and contains two campgrounds that are open year-round. The campgrounds can accommodate anything from a simple tent to a large RV. Most of the 346 campsites have 30- and 50-amp electric hookups as well as water and sewer hookups. Campers can enjoy swimming, fishing, kayaking, boating, bird watching, hiking, and so much more. Park amenities include:

  • A camp store and tackle shop
  • Two on-site restaurants: Hammerheads and The Big Chill Beach Club
  • Bathhouses and laundry facilities
  • A full-service marina

Rates at the year-round park differ depending on the type of site you require and the time of year you choose to camp. A campsite on a peak weekday runs about $52 a night, while a tent-only site in the wintertime might only cost $20 a night.

    Perfect for families, Sandy Hill Family Camp boasts an excellent location right on the Nanticoke River. In addition to an excellent selection of campsites with picnic tables and fire rings, the property offers a children’s playground, two boat launches, a swimming beach, and a large hall with a dedicated games room. The restrooms are equipped with hot water and flush toilets, and campground amenities include a laundromat, a dump station, and a general store. The campground is open between the middle of March and the middle of December, and off-season storage is available for anyone who wants to store their RV on-site.

    5752 Sandy Hill Rd, Quantico, MD 21856, Phone: 410-873-2471
